A plein air painting trip to Whittier, Alaska, was occasioned by major construction in the act of building a railway bridge jutting out into Prince William Sound for arriving barges to unload their cargo. The water is deep and cold, and because Whittier is like a small pocket surrounded by mountains, it is considered the birth place of the wind. These workers were inspecting the newest portion of the bridge, back-lit by the windswept sea.
